Iran English language newspaper headlines on Tuesday, 15-1-2019

Iran Daily

Rouhani: US, allies schemes will fail

President Hassan Rouhani assured the Iranian nation that Iran is the party that will eventually emerge victorious from the ongoing campaign of sanctions and pressure that the country has been subjected to by the United States and its allies.

S. Korea to receive Iranian condensate after 4-month gap

A South Korean oil buyer is set to receive about two million barrels of Iranian condensate in January, a source familiar with the matter said on Monday.

Turkey vows not to be intimidated by Trump threats

Turkey on Monday vowed it would not be intimidated by US President Donald Trumps threats of economic devastation if Ankara attacks Kurdish forces as American troops withdraw.

Trump denies ever working for Russia, blasts investigators

US President Donald Trump denied Monday he ever worked for Russia, answering a question he declined to directly address over the weekend.

Zarif: Dialogue must replace war to strengthen region

Irans Foreign Minister Mohammad Javad Zarif said if regional countries want a strong region, they must substitute dialogue for war as well as cooperation for arms race.

Syrian president, Irans delegation discuss ties

Syrian President Bashar al-Assad and an Iranian parliamentary delegation on Monday discussed decades-long strategic relations between the two countries.

Qassemi: Iran will not wait for others permission to launch satellite

Iranian Foreign Ministry spokesman Bahram Qassemi said Iran will not wait for other countries permission to launch satellite into orbit.

Irans envoy denounces UK interference in Irans internal affairs

Iranian Ambassador to London Hamid Baeedinejad on Monday denounced the European countrys interference in Irans internal affairs after he was summoned over the imprisoned Iranian-British citizen, Nazanin Zaghari-Ratcliffe.

Tehran Times

3rd round of offering oil at IRENEX on Jan. 21
National Iranian Oil Company (NIOC) will offer one million barrels of light crude oil at Iran Energy Exchange (IRENEX) for the third time on January 21, IRNA reported on Monday.

Iran talked to Taliban to foil plot by Daesh backers: MP
Majlis National Security and Foreign Policy Committee Chairman Heshmatollah Falahatpisheh has said that Iran held talks with Taliban to foil plots by Daesh supports in Afghanistan.

Bomb-packed car blows up near high-security compound in Kabul

A bomb-laden car blew up outside a high-security compound that is home to several international companies and charities in the Afghan capital Kabul Monday, causing a number of casualties, security officials said.

Boeing 707 cargo plane crashes near Tehran, claims 16 lives
A Boeing 707 cargo plane, with 17 people on board, crashed in Safadasht, near Tehran, on Monday morning, leaving 16 dead and one injured, ISNA news agency
reported.

Turkey responds to Trump Twitter threat
U.S. President Donald Trump threatened Turkey with economic devastation if it attacks a U.S.-allied Kurdish militia in Syria, drawing a sharp rebuke from Ankara Monday and reviving fears of another downturn in ties between the NATO allies.

Mountain goats in northwestern resort
A pack of nine goats has recently been released into Eynali Mount, which is home to a gigantic recreational resort in northwestern Iran.

High-profile meetings in Baghdad
Iraqi Prime Minister Adil Abdul-Mahdi held talks late on Sunday in Baghdad with Iranian Foreign Minister Mohammad Javad Zarif and his accompanying team.

Iran says still honoring nuclear deal
Tehran says its move to design a modern process for 20-percent uranium enrichment does not run against its compliance with the 2015 nuclear agreement, officially known as the JCPOA in its English abbreviation and BARJAM in Persian.

Rouhani says Iran to launch Payam satellite soon
President Hassan Rouhani of Iran said on Monday that the Payam satellite will soon be launched into space with an altitude of 600 kilometers.

Iraqi MP says Zarifs visit to Baghdad heralds new opportunities
Forat al-Tamimi, an Iraqi MP, has said that Iranian Foreign Minister Mohammad Javad Zarifs visit to Iraq is very important that will create new oppor-tunities for economic cooperation.

Pompeo in Mideast to corner Iran but Tehran not cowed
U.S. Secretary of State Mike Pompeo has been touring the Middle East to rally support against Iran, but Tehran is not impressed.
